什么是区块链?

区块链是一种以区块为单位的数据结构,通过分布式网络中的节点共同维护的一种账本技术。每个区块包含了一定数量的交易记录,并通过加密算法与前一个区块相连接,形成一条链。这条链是不可篡改的,因为一旦数据被写入区块中,就无法再更改。而每个节点都有一份完整的账本副本,这就确保了信息的透明性和安全性。

区块链的工作原理

区块链的工作原理可以简单地分为几个步骤。首先,用户发起交易,交易信息被广播到网络中的所有节点。接下来,节点会验证这些交易的合法性。经过验证后,将交易打包进入一个新的区块中。这个新块会经过多方节点的确认,然后通过强大的加密算法与前一个区块相连接,最终形成一条完整的链路。

区块链的去中心化特征

去中心化是区块链技术的一个显著特征。传统的中心化数据存储方式通常依赖于一家机构的数据中心来维护数据,容易受到单点故障的影响。而区块链通过分布式网络技术,打破了这一局限。每一个节点都可以参与到数据的存储与维护中,这不仅提高了系统的可靠性,也减少了对中心化管理的依赖。

区块链技术的安全性

区块链的安全性主要来自于它的加密机制。每个区块都使用哈希算法生成唯一的标识符,并存储有时间戳和交易信息。这使得一旦信息被写入以后,任何试图更改的数据都会导致该区块的哈希值发生变化,从而被网络中的其他节点拒绝。此外,分布式存储也降低了数据遭到攻击或丢失的风险。

区块链的应用领域

区块链技术的应用领域极为广泛,包括金融、医疗、供应链、版权保护等多个行业。在金融方面,区块链能够实现更快速、更低成本的跨境支付;在医疗领域,区块链可以用于患者数据的安全存储与共享;在供应链管理中,区块链能够提供产品的追踪和验证,大幅提高透明度。

未来展望与挑战

尽管区块链技术的前景被广泛看好,但在实际应用中仍面临诸多挑战。例如,技术的成熟度、标准的缺失以及合规性问题等。同时,区块链在处理速度和能耗问题上的改善也是未来需要解决的关键点。随着技术的不断进步,区块链或将迎来更加广泛的应用和变革。

常见的区块链相关问题

在了解了区块链的基本概念、工作原理、安全性、应用领域及未来展望后,很多用户可能会有更深层次的问题。以下是一些与区块链相关的常见问题及其详细解答:

区块链如何保证数据的安全性和隐私?

区块链保证数据安全性的方式主要依赖于其内置的加密机制和分布式账本特性。每一笔交易都必须经过网络中的节点验证,而交易的每一块都具有唯一的哈希值,这使得一旦数据被写入,就无法被篡改。此外,区块链中的数据通常使用公私钥机制进行加密,用户只有通过自己的私钥才能访问特定的数据,而其他人无法解读。这就确保了用户的隐私不被泄露。同时,通过交易的匿名性,区块链用户可以在不暴露自己身份的情况下进行交易。

区块链与传统数据库的区别在哪?

区块链和传统数据库之间有几个关键区别。首先,区块链是分布式的,所有的节点都可以访问信息并参与数据的维护,而传统数据库通常是中心化的,数据存储在单一服务器上。其次,区块链注重事务的完整性和透明性,所有的交易都被永久记录,并且任何人都可以查看,而传统数据库则更多地侧重于数据的快速读取与写入。最后,区块链的安全性来源于加密结构和共识算法,而传统数据库通常依赖于中心化的安全机制。

如何进行区块链的开发?

区块链开发通常涉及多个步骤和技术。在开始之前,需要明确开发的目标及其应用场景。接下来,可以选择合适的区块链平台(如以太坊、Hyperledger等),然后通过相应的编程语言(如Solidity、JavaScript、Golang等)进行智能合约的编写与部署。最后,通过测试和完善确保区块链网络的安全稳定。在整个过程中,了解区块链的共识机制及其加密技术至关重要,以确保开发出的应用满足安全性和扩展性要求。

区块链如何改变我们的生活方式?

区块链技术正在逐步渗透到我们的日常生活中。从金融与支付到医疗与教育,区块链提供了一种新的方式来进行数据存储和交易。例如,使用区块链技术进行的跨境支付更快且成本更低,解决了传统银行手续繁琐的问题;在医疗行业,患者的健康记录可以通过区块链进行安全地共享,提升医疗服务的效率;在版权保护中,艺术家可以通过区块链追踪作品的使用情况并确保自己的权益。

区块链技术的未来发展趋势是什么?

区块链的未来发展趋势主要体现在几个方面。首先,随着技术的进步,区块链的性能将不断,例如提高交易处理速度、降低能耗等。其次,行业间的跨链合作将成为一大趋势,不同区块链之间的数据互通能力将增强。此外,随着监管框架的完善和标准化的建立,区块链将得到更广泛的应用,尤其在金融、物流、医疗等行业。

区块链面临哪些法律和监管挑战?

区块链技术的快速发展引发了许多法律和监管的挑战。首先,数字资产的合法性与属性尚未统一,各国的法律法规差异巨大,导致区块链应用面临合规性问题。其次,数据隐私保护法规(如GDPR)与区块链的去中心化特性之间存在矛盾。此外,区块链相关的金融犯罪(如洗钱、诈骗等)也使得各国监管机构需加强监管措施,以确保不破坏整个金融体系的稳定。

最终,通过以上讨论,我们对区块链有了更为深入的理解,突显了它在现代社会中的重要性及未来发展的可能性。尽管仍面临挑战,但不容忽视的是,区块链技术的创新潜力和积极影响将逐步改变我们生活的方方面面。